Defence Industries Will Deliver Robust Solutions For Safer Nigeria In 2026 – Chief Executive

The Defence Industries Corporation of Nigeria (DICON) has said it will deliver robust defence solutions for a safer and stronger Nigeria in 2026, reaffirming its commitment to strengthening Nigeria’s defence and security architecture.

In an end-of-year message issued by the chief executive officer of DICON-D7G, Osman Chennar, on Monday, pledged deeper collaboration with government institutions, private sector partners and global allies in 2026.

While expressing appreciation to stakeholders, partners and the public for their sustained trust and cooperation, Chennar described the outgoing year as a defining period in the pursuit of national security and sustainable development.

“As we draw the curtain on another defining year, we extend our profound gratitude to our esteemed stakeholders, partners and the general public for their unwavering trust, collaboration and shared belief in our collective mission,” he said.

Reaffirming support for President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s Renewed Hope Agenda, the DICON-D7G boss stated that the policy direction continues to provide purposeful leadership, inspire national resilience, and drive strategic transformation across critical sectors.

“We proudly reaffirm our resolute support for the President’s Renewed Hope Agenda, which places security, stability and sustainable development at the heart of nation-building. At DICON-D7G, we remain deeply committed to national service and fully aligned with this vision,” Chennar stated.

Looking ahead to 2026, he said the organisation was entering the new year with renewed confidence and determination, noting that fresh opportunities would be explored to deepen innovation and strengthen partnerships.

Chennar said the DICON-D7G will continue to work collaboratively with relevant government agencies, private sector players and international partners to safeguard national interests and contribute meaningfully to a safer and stronger Nigeria.

He assured the Federal Government under President Tinubu that 2026 would be characterised by impactful growth, strategic expansion and purposeful engagement within the defence and security ecosystem.

“Together, we will continue to build trust, enhance capacity and champion initiatives that promote peace, security and sustainable national development,” Chennar added.

DICON-D7G is a strategic defence manufacturing and services partnership operating under the framework of the Defence Industries Corporation of Nigeria, with a mandate to promote local defence production, technology transfer and capacity building. The partnership plays a key role in efforts to deepen Nigeria’s defence industrial base and reduce reliance on foreign military procurement.
